Gleason, published by Princeton University Press in 2008. This compelling 232-page paperback delves into the anxieties surrounding male behavior and identity during a transformative period in history. Gleason expertly analyzes the contrasting lives and writings of two Sophists, Favorinus—a eunuch—and Polemo, who embodied traditional gender norms. Through this examination, the book reveals how character and gender were perceived and constructed in Greco-Roman society.
